Transaction d0021a9c63a53fcf9b70bc5190d95a8e6df2052973eebbe13cbf2994bd955721
1 Input
1 Output
-
d0021a9c63a53fcf9b70bc5190d95a8e6df2052973eebbe13cbf2994bd955721:0
- value
- 20278892
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 db3b0fcb74c631e3bf6f5bd4e3b855dee489ef08 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LzBjgzotoHgJnB7eYovyZx1FLB8Kc75mR